Spencer Platt/Getty Images Ciudad Juarez -- just across the border from El Paso, Texas -- has long been coveted by Mexico's narco traffickers, representing a gateway into the voracious US drug market. Fighting for control of Juarez turned it into one of the most violent cities in the world between 2008 and 2012, but, much to the relief of people on both sides of the border, that violence has eased.
